Christ's resurrection doesn't mean escaping from the world; it means mission to the world based on Jesus's lordship over the world.
N. T. Wright

Interpretation

What this quote means

The resurrection of Christ signifies a call to engage with the world rather than withdraw from it.

N. T. Wright's quote emphasizes that Christ's resurrection is not merely a promise of escape from worldly troubles but rather a directive to actively participate in the world under the authority of Jesus. This mission is grounded in recognizing His sovereignty, urging believers to engage in transformative actions that reflect their faith and commitment to His teachings.
